Barratt Redrow has declared an interim dividend of 5.5 pence per share

Barratt Redrow has declared an interim dividend of 5.5 pence per share (HY24: 4.4 pence per share). The interim dividend will be paid on Friday 16 May 2025 to all shareholders on the register on Friday 4 April 2025. 

 Other Financial highlights include:

Good operational performance, delivering 6,846 total home completions3 (HY24: 6,171R and 7,777A), with adjusted profit before tax at £167.1m (HY24: £157.1mR and £248.8mA) after purchase price allocation ("PPA") adjustments of £50.4m.

Net private weekly reservation rate up 33% to 0.60 compared to 0.45A aggregated performance for Barratt and Redrow in the comparable period (HY24: 0.48R).

Redrow integration progressing well with nine divisional office closures completed or announced across both businesses and wider integration programme now on track to deliver £100m of cost synergies.

Adjusted items relating to Redrow transaction and integration costs totalled £49.9m (HY24: £nilR) with no incremental building safety remediation costs charged in the half (HY24: £61.9mR), resulting in reported profit before tax of £117.2m (HY24: £95.2mR).

Balance sheet remains strong with net cash of £458.9m (31 December 2023: £753.4mR and £874.4mA), after payment of the FY24 final dividend of £170.5m across the combined shareholder base in November (FY23 final dividend: £228.0mR) and incremental investment in land and work in progress of £332m.

Interim ordinary dividend increased by 25% to 5.5p (HY24: 4.4pR) reflecting planned FY25 1.75 times adjusted earnings cover, before the impact of PPA adjustments. This includes four months' contribution of Redrow profits.

Full year adjusted profit before tax, before the impact of PPA adjustments, is now expected to be at the upper end of market expectations.
